Pretzel Circuil
Today we made a Circuit where the pretzel bag represented a battery, the students represented electrons, the pretzels represented volts and there where two students with a box that represented light bulbs. We did this in a Series Circuit and on an Parallel Circuit.
In a Series Circuit the current always stays the same, this means that when 30 electrons (students) passes by the battery (pretzel bag) there was going to be 30 electrons passing through each light bulb. And in a Parallel Circuit the current will add up that means that if 28 electrons passed by the battery theres was going to be 16 electrons passing through one light bulb and 14 passing through the other one.
